    Onto the important stuff now, with time on my hands,
    and a much cleared head, I had a look at them at Kelso.

    I’m a big fan of Sean Quinlan, I reckon he’s an underated
    Jockey. It’s a family affair, his wife Lizzie(trainer) got
    Rauzan from Eoin Doyle in Ireland last November. I bit slow
    to come to hand (125/1 1st time out)but in his 5th race he was
    3rd in a £20,000 race at Kelso and last time out he was 2nd at
    3/1 in a good match with Kado Sacree (11/10 fav) where they ran
    away from the other 2. He hasn’t been penalised for that and I
    think he has a real good shout.

    2.30 Kelso Rauzan 10/1 Paddy Power.

    The other one that’s of interest to me is Erne River, who used to be
    a darned good horse. He’s 11 now, and doesn’t run in the 140s that
    he used to but he’s dropped down to his lightest weight on a mark
    of 126. He also has Tom Broughton taking 5lbs off his back, has a 13%
    win rate. If the old boy has any of his old magic left, 2nd to hitman
    in the Graduation Race and finishing off a 4 timer when he routed the
    field, waltzing in at wetherby at 1/2. That’s a few years back but he
    should be as well as he can be after his last run after a couple of
    months off.

    3.30 Kelso Erne River 12/1 Bet365
